敏捷需求管理与传统有何区别?
敏捷需求管理与传统需求管理的区别主要体现在以下几个方面:
一、管理理念的不同
- 敏捷需求管理
敏捷需求管理强调的是快速响应市场变化,关注客户需求,以客户为中心。敏捷需求管理认为,需求是一个不断变化的过程,因此在整个项目周期中,需求管理是一个持续迭代、逐步完善的过程。
- 传统需求管理
传统需求管理强调的是需求规划、需求收集、需求分析、需求确认和需求变更等阶段。在项目初期,需求被详细规划,并在项目后期进行变更控制。
二、需求获取方式的不同
- 敏捷需求管理
敏捷需求管理采用多种方式获取需求,如用户故事、看板、迭代计划会议等。这些方式能够帮助团队快速了解客户需求,并在此基础上进行迭代开发。
- 传统需求管理
传统需求管理主要通过问卷调查、访谈、需求规格说明书等方式获取需求。这些方式相对较为繁琐,需要花费较长时间。
三、需求变更管理的不同
- 敏捷需求管理
敏捷需求管理认为,需求变更是一种正常现象,因此在整个项目周期中,需求变更管理贯穿始终。敏捷团队会根据实际情况,对需求进行快速调整。
- 传统需求管理
传统需求管理对需求变更持谨慎态度,通常在项目后期才进行需求变更。一旦需求变更,可能会导致项目延期、成本增加等问题。
四、团队协作方式的不同
- 敏捷需求管理
敏捷需求管理强调团队协作,鼓励团队成员共同参与需求分析、需求确认和需求变更等工作。这种协作方式有助于提高团队整体素质,缩短项目周期。
- 传统需求管理
传统需求管理中,需求管理主要由项目经理或需求分析师负责,团队成员参与度较低。这种模式可能导致需求理解偏差,影响项目质量。
五、项目交付方式的不同
- 敏捷需求管理
敏捷需求管理采用迭代交付方式,即按照一定的周期(如两周、一个月等)完成一个或多个功能模块,并及时交付给客户。这种方式有助于客户及时了解项目进展,并根据反馈调整需求。
- 传统需求管理
传统需求管理采用阶段交付方式,即按照项目阶段(如需求分析、设计、开发、测试等)进行交付。这种方式可能导致客户对项目进展了解不足,无法及时反馈。
六、风险管理方式的不同
- 敏捷需求管理
敏捷需求管理注重风险管理,认为风险是项目过程中不可避免的一部分。敏捷团队会定期进行风险评估,并根据风险情况调整需求。
- 传统需求管理
传统需求管理对风险管理较为重视,但在实际操作中,往往将风险管理视为一种被动应对措施。这种模式可能导致风险在项目后期集中爆发。
总结
敏捷需求管理与传统需求管理在管理理念、需求获取方式、需求变更管理、团队协作方式、项目交付方式和风险管理等方面存在较大差异。敏捷需求管理更加注重客户需求、团队协作和快速响应市场变化,而传统需求管理则更注重需求规划和变更控制。在实际应用中,应根据项目特点和团队实际情况,选择合适的需求管理方法。
猜你喜欢:研发项目管理平台